Fruits and Vegetables in Your Child’s Diet Are Important
The 2015-2020 Dietary Guidelines for Americans recommends that kids eat a healthy diet that includes a whole bunch of fruits, veggies, whole grains, fat-free and low-fat dairy products, plenty of protein foods, and oils.
Empty calories from added sugars and solid fats make up 40% of daily calories our kids and teens consume, from 2 to 18 years of age. Those ingredients negatively affect the quality of their diet, so because of this, empty calorie foods that you want to limit include sodas, fruit drinks, dairy desserts, grain desserts, and pizza.
